On Monday 28th November the Council passed the budget unanimously without increasing the Commercial Rates as was originally recommended. A number of adjustments were made to some figures in light of better estimates.
The Budget also includes 2 extra staff for Greystones as a result of a review of driver numbers. I analysed the figures and complained for years that there weren’t enough staff to cope with the rapid growth in Greystones and last year voted against the budget. The street cleaning machine has remained in the depot as there wasn’t anyone to drive it. The Chief Executive has committed to ensuring it is used and it has now been sent for maintenance. Numbers of other categories of staff will be reviewed next year.
